1 / 6About Alasassy Font
Alasassy is an informal typeface that is designed to liven up logos, headlines, informal signs, advertising, book or report covers, or packaging. It’s narrow and looks hand-written, as though it had been drawn with a felt-tip pen that left little ink balls on the ends of letters. Alasassy includes both lowercase and uppercase letters, with alternate characters that mix high and low crossbars, giving the design versatility and a whimsical feeling. Type designer Andrea Leksen wrote out pages of Sharpie pen drawings to get the look she wanted for Alasassy. She describes it as “a great combination of an organic, hand drawn feel but still clean and crisp enough to look professional.” Alasassy is offered in three weights—Regular, Bold, and Black—with italic complements for each. The Pro version contains more language support, including Cyrillic and Greek. The Caps version mixes capital and lowercase letter shapes that share the same height.
How to Install Alasassy Font
Step-by-step instructions for every platform
- 1Download the Alasassy font file (.ttf or .otf).
- 2Locate the downloaded file in your Downloads folder.
- 3Right-click the font file.
- 4Select "Install" to install for the current user, or "Install for all users" to make it available system-wide.
- 5Alasassy is now available in Word, Photoshop, Illustrator, and all other apps.
